摘要

The goal of this paper is to evaluate the performance of public transit systems based on a combined evaluation method (CEM) consisting of information entropy theory and super efficiency data envelopment analysis (SE-DEA). Taking 13 transit operators in Yangtze Delta Region of China as the research object, we integrate the public transit industry regulations, transit operation and passenger requirements to construct an evaluation indicator system based on satisfaction and efficiency. The CEM is used to evaluate the performance. The results show significant differences in the efficiency scores between CEM and SE-DEA. The CEM can reduce the risks of SE-DEA affected by the dimensions of indicators, and improve its discrimination capability. The evaluation outcomes of the CEM seem to be more objective, therefore, provide a more suitable basis for decision-making related to public transit service performance, as well as for the study of operation and management. 机译:本文的目的是基于由信息熵理论和超高效数据包络分析(SE-DEA)组成的组合评估方法(CEM)来评估公交系统的性能。以长三角地区的13个公交运营商为研究对象,结合公交行业法规,公交运营和旅客需求,构建基于满意度和效率的评价指标体系。 CEM用于评估性能。结果表明,CEM和SE-DEA的效率得分存在显着差异。 CEM可以减少SE-DEA受指标尺寸影响的风险,并提高其判别能力。 CEM的评估结果似乎更加客观,因此,为与公交服务绩效相关的决策以及运营和管理研究提供了更合适的基础。 (C)2015 Elsevier Ltd.保留所有权利。
